The Ultimate Guide to Window Insulation: Enhancing Comfort and Efficiency
In the pursuit of higher energy effectiveness and convenience within our homes, window insulation plays an essential function. Windows are among the main sources of heat loss in a home, accounting for as much as 30% of a structure's heating energy loss. For that reason, understanding how to insulate windows successfully can lead to substantial cost savings on energy expenses while improving the overall atmosphere of a home.
What is Window Insulation?
Window insulation includes numerous methods and items developed to decrease heat transfer through windows, improving the home's energy performance. Insulation can be achieved through multiple methods, including utilizing specialized window films, including thermal curtains, and using a series of insulation products. Kinds Of Window Insulation
There are several typical methods to insulate windows, each with its advantages and disadvantages. The table listed below sums up the most popular window insulation choices.
Window Insulation MethodDescriptionProsConsWeatherstrippingSealing spaces around window frames with adhesive strips.Cost-efficient, simple to install.Limited impact if windows are old or damaged.Window FilmsTransparent films used to the window surface.Minimizes UV rays, boosts privacy, and is low-cost.May need Professional Window Installation installation for best results.Thermal CurtainsHeavy drapes designed to trap air and decrease heat loss.Includes aesthetic appeal, simple to use.Needs routine cleansing, might obstruct natural light.Double or Triple GlazingWindows with several glass panes separated by a gas layer.Exceptional thermal resistance and sound insulation.Higher in advance expenses, heavier frames needed.Secondary GlazingIncluding a secondary layer of glass or plastic over existing windows.Improved insulation without changing windows.Can be less aesthetically enticing, might require installation.Insulating ShuttersExterior or interior shutters that supply extra insulation.Robust insulation, energy efficient.Greater installation expenses, potential for maintenance.Benefits of Window Insulation
Insulating windows uses many benefits beyond simply energy savings. Here are a few of the most significant benefits:
Energy Efficiency: Properly insulated windows can significantly minimize heating and cooling costs, resulting in lower monthly energy bills.Increased Comfort: Insulation helps preserve consistent indoor temperatures, lowering drafts and cold areas that can make spaces uneasy.Sound Reduction: Many insulation approaches, specifically double or triple glazing, can also lessen outdoors sound, supplying a quieter living environment.UV Protection: Window films and particular curtains can block damaging UV rays from destructive furnishings and flooring.Environmental Impact: Increased energy effectiveness means a reduced carbon footprint, contributing to environmental sustainability.Picking the Right Insulation for Your Windows
